:age LIMIT :num";$map = ['age'=>16 , 'nmu'=>2];$res = Db::query( $sql, $map);var_dump($res);Fehlermeldung: SQLSTATE[HY093]: Ungültiger Absatz"> Fehler SQLSTATE[HY093]: Ungültige Parameternummer: Parameter wurde nicht definiert-Fragen und Antworten zum chinesischen PHP-Netzwerk
Fehler SQLSTATE[HY093]: Ungültige Parameternummer: Parameter wurde nicht definiert
索马里海草
索马里海草 2020-02-15 23:47:07
0
1
2961

Der Code lautet wie folgt:

$sql = "select * from user where age>:age LIMIT :num";
$map = ['age'=>16 , 'nmu'=>2];
$ res = Db ::query($sql,$map);
var_dump($res);

Fehlermeldung: SQLSTATE[HY093]: Ungültige Parameternummer: Parameter wurde nicht definiert

Fehlermeldung: [10501]SQLSTATE[ HY093]: Ungültige Parameternummer: Parameter wurde nicht definiert[D:wwwroottp6.comvendortopthinkthink-ormsrcdbPDOConnection.php:722]

索马里海草
索马里海草

Antworte allen (1)
phpcn_u88663

已经解决,看了后面的教程,老师说是参数未定义,传参错误,然后仔细检查了下,原来是 num写错了

    Neueste Downloads
    Mehr>
    Web-Effekte
    Quellcode der Website
    Website-Materialien
    Frontend-Vorlage
    Über uns Haftungsausschluss Sitemap
    Chinesische PHP-Website:Online-PHP-Schulung für das Gemeinwohl,Helfen Sie PHP-Lernenden, sich schnell weiterzuentwickeln!